Indian Security

Whenever you go to an upmarket hotel or Mall you have to walk through a metal detector, be swiped with a metal detector wand and have your bag searched. If you arrive in a car, mirrors are rolled under to check there is no car bomb attached to the underside and the boot is checked.

Every time I walk through the metal detector, I always set it off. I am then swiped by the wand, which beeps furiously, a lady casts an eye into my bag without a proper check and then I am waved on.

Every time this happens, it’s all I can muster not to say out loud as I walk on, ‘Ha, yet again I manage to smuggle my AK-47s through tight Indian security!’
